Understanding the 800 kW Generator

An 800 kW generator refers to a power-generating machine capable of producing up to 800 kilowatts of electrical power. This output is suitable for various applications, including commercial operations, construction sites, and large-scale events. The generator can run on different fuel sources like diesel, natural gas, or even renewable options, thereby tailoring the choice to specific requirements. With varying sizes, noise levels, and fuel efficiencies available in the market, understanding the specifications that matter most for your needs is vital.

Strengths and Weaknesses of 800 kW Generators

Strengths

  1. High Power Output: The capacity to deliver 800 kW makes these generators ideal for powering large facilities or multiple smaller setups.
  2. Versatility: These generators can be utilized in diverse scenarios, from temporary power during construction to emergency backup for hospitals.
  3. Increased Reliability: A well-maintained 800 kW generator can provide consistent performance, ensuring operations run smoothly without the risk of power interruptions.

Weaknesses

  1. Operational Costs: While these generators are powerful, they can also incur higher fuel and maintenance costs, particularly with diesel variants.
  2. Size and Portability: An 800 kW generator can be large and may require substantial space. Transporting them to different locations may not always be feasible without logistics planning.
  3. Noise Levels: Depending on the model, some generators can be quite loud, which could be a concern in residential areas or quiet environments.

Key Comparisons for 800 kW Generators

Fuel Type: Diesel vs. Natural Gas

  • Diesel Generators: Often more powerful and efficient, diesel generators are the preferred choice for many large-scale operations. However, they tend to be noisier and require more regular maintenance.

  • Natural Gas Generators: These are generally quieter and cleaner but may have slightly less power output than their diesel counterparts. For businesses looking to minimize their carbon footprint, natural gas generators offer an attractive alternative.

Fixed vs. Portable Generators

  • Fixed Generators: Installed permanently, these generators can provide seamless, around-the-clock power with automatic transfer switches. They suit businesses needing consistent power supply without interruption.

  • Portable Generators: While offering flexibility and mobility, they usually require manual operation and aren’t designed for continuous service over long periods. They can be great for temporary jobs or short-term power requirements.

Maintenance and Practical Tips for Your 800 kW Generator

To ensure your 800 kW generator performs optimally, regular maintenance is key. Here are some practical tips:

  1. Routine Inspections: Conduct regular checks on fuel levels, oil quality, and the functioning of the electrical components to catch issues early.

  2. Scheduled Maintenance: Establish a consistent maintenance schedule with a qualified technician to keep the generator in peak condition.

  3. Load Testing: Perform regular load tests to ensure that your generator can handle the required power output without any issues.

  4. Fuel Quality: For diesel generators, use high-quality fuel and consider adding biocides to prevent microbial growth in storage tanks.
